Ensuring Refined Sugar Refinement: Clarity and Sheen

The production of granulated sugar isn’t simply about extracting sweetness from sugarcane or sugar beets; it’s a meticulously controlled production journey focused on achieving exceptional purity. Initially, raw sugar, often characterized check here by a brown or amber hue due to the presence of molasses and other impurities, undergoes a series of clarification steps. These may include liming to remove colorants and subsequent bleaching through methods like activated filtration. The goal throughout this intricate sequence is to eliminate virtually all components, resulting in a product with a remarkably excellent degree of whiteness and a crystalline, even sheen. Further recrystallization ensures a desirable grain size for optimal application in a vast range of baking products.

Understanding ICUMSA Measurements in Refined Sugars

Assessing the shade of refined sweetener is often accomplished through the use of ICUMSA values, a standardized technique developed by the International Commission for Uniform Methods of Sugar Analysis. These metric indicators reflect the levels of {color-producing|darkening|brown) compounds, primarily invert sugars, present in the finished product. A lower ICUMSA number generally implies a brighter and more highly refined sugar, desirable for many purposes like confectionery and beverages. However, it’s important to remember that acceptable ICUMSA ranges can change depending on the specific intended application and customer expectations; a slightly higher measurement might be perfectly acceptable – and even preferred – in some instances.
